California Lawmakers Oppose Gov. Newsom's Loan for Diablo Canyon Nuclear Plant

Legislature's vote against $400 million funding highlights concerns over rising costs and safety risks

  • The legislature's decision marks a significant break with Gov. Gavin Newsom's energy strategy.
  • Estimated costs for extending the plant's operation have surged to nearly $12 billion.
  • Diablo Canyon produces up to 9% of California's electricity but faces safety concerns from nearby faults.
  • Newsom argues the plant is essential to prevent blackouts as the state transitions to renewable energy.
  • The debate occurs amid California's efforts to address a $45 billion budget deficit.
